Communal Gardens, Tufnell Park N19

In 2016, we were commissioned to design the communal gardens for a new residential development in Tufnell Park, comprising six mews houses connected by gravel pathways.

To soften the urban setting, we planted the perimeter walls with a mix of climbing plants and flowering shrubs, creating a lush living green wall around the development.

Since completion, the gardens have been regularly cared for by our maintenance team, helping the planting mature and thrive year after year.
